Transaction 3e4d732007799933ba377788663fa863b6f647288ffc1b6881fff8ba67502014

3 Input
2 Outputs
  • 3e4d732007799933ba377788663fa863b6f647288ffc1b6881fff8ba67502014:0
  • value  170704
    address  1E4thX31ZUuJwqv6HdaTJGLpNwD4CbbycD
  • 3e4d732007799933ba377788663fa863b6f647288ffc1b6881fff8ba67502014:1
  • value  860204
    address  1DKeNwrhPNgCmdoPTS3eSWfbmLuS1KDdGF